Ticket: Staging env misconfigured for Siftgate bloom filter

The bloom layer in front of the Pellet KV store is rejecting all lookups in staging because the env file was copied from the dev template without credentials. False-positive tuning values are fine; only the auth line is missing. To unblock the weekly demo, the Pellet admission secret must be set on the following line.

env line for yaguf-fajop: LEDGER_TOKEN13=fb08984397349

Ticket: Connection pool starvation in the Fenwick reporting service. Long-running analytics queries hold pooled connections past the 60s lease, so interactive requests queue and time out. Proposed fix: separate pools for analytics and interactive traffic, plus a lease-expiry metric. Future maintainers should keep the pools split. First build exhibiting the regression is noted below.

pipeline stamp: htk9_ce63042d9

Capacity note for the Bramblewick export retry queue. Failed exports are requeued with exponential backoff, and the queue depth is our main capacity signal: sustained depth above the high-water mark means downstream Pellis storage is saturated, not that we need more workers. As the new contractor, please don't raise worker counts without checking storage latency first — it usually makes things worse. Retry timing, backoff caps, and the high-water threshold are all driven by the constants shown below.

limits module of yagef-bajog:
TIERS = {
    "druael": 370,
    "tamix": 286,
    "pelius": 541,
    "pelael": 78,
    "pelox": 47,
    "ralath": 533,
    "drumir": 801,
}

Onboarding: Tumblevault locker flow. Users drop laundry, the Spinstack app issues a one-time locker code, the courier redeems it. Review focus: code expiry (15 min), single-use enforcement, and audit logging on every open event. The service talks to the locker hardware gateway over mTLS, but the gateway's management API still uses a static credential loaded at boot from the env file. Reject any PR that reads it from anywhere else. That credential appears on the line of the env file shown below.

secret setting of yagef-baweg: RELAY_SECRET29=cb53deb59a49ed54d9f43599b54ca